The Scheppach RS350 Rotating Soil Sieve is an essential tool for home gardeners and landscapers who need to refine soil, compost, or sand for planting and top-dressing. Driven by a 250W motor, this machine automates the screening process to remove debris, rocks, and clumps, significantly saving time compared to manual sifting. While it excels at efficiency, users should be aware that it requires a level surface for optimal stability and performance during operation.

FAQs

Can I use this for wet soil?

It is best to use dry or slightly damp materials. Very wet, sticky soil may clog the mesh inserts.

How do I change the mesh inserts?

The inserts are designed to be easily removed and swapped. Refer to your manual for the specific locking mechanism on your model.

What is the power consumption?

The motor is rated at 250W, making it suitable for standard domestic power outlets.

Is the RS350 weatherproof?

The unit should be kept dry. It is not designed to be left outside in the rain; store it in a covered area after use.

Can I sift sand with this tool?

Yes, it is excellent for sifting sand, provided you use the appropriate fine mesh insert.

Troubleshooting

Drum not rotating

Verify that the power cable is firmly connected and check the circuit breaker. Ensure the drum is not overloaded with material.

Material not sifting properly

Adjust the angle of the drum or clean the mesh inserts to ensure they are not clogged with damp soil.

Unit vibrating excessively

Ensure the device is positioned on a flat, level surface and that all fasteners are tightened securely.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up is straightforward: place the sieve on a flat, stable surface to prevent tipping during operation. Adjust the drum angle based on the material texture; a steeper angle helps move material faster, while a shallower angle provides more thorough sifting. To ensure long-term reliability, clear the mesh inserts of trapped debris after each use to prevent rust or motor strain. The unit is designed for standard electrical outlets. Keep the unit dry and store it in a sheltered area to protect the motor components from moisture.
